Fuel Question 200 1993

I just purchased a 1993 240, with just over 100,000 miles. My question is should I run premium unleaded gas or can I run regular unleaded. Also, what kind of oil do you think is best? I know a lot of people like synthetic. Thanks for the advice.








  REPLY TO THIS MESSAGE Replies to this message will be emailed.    PRINT   SAVE 

Re: Fuel Question 200 1993

Scott,

Use the lowest grade octane you can without pinging. I have an 86 with 214,700mi. and use regualar gas (no probleams) It doesn't seem to run any better on mid-grade or super so why pay the extra cash unless you have too. Maybe you could do a couple tankfulls each grade and do some mileage

tests to make a more scientific determination.

As for the oil everbody has their own opinions. I use Exxon Superflo...I always buy it on sale and always send in for the rebate so it usually costs me about 75 cents/qt.

I do change may oil every 2,500 miles. Most everone on this board will suggest the use of Mann filters. I am currently making the switch even though I have never had a problem with Fram. My car runs mint and does not burn any oil...in fact it's the only car I've ever had that gives back all the oil I put it (less whats in the filter)

Good luck with your new purchase...May it serve you well for many hundreds of thousands of miles !!!

Re: Fuel Question 200 1993

Scott, Welcome to the board, start with reg. unleaded , if it pings upgrade to medium, if it still pings use super. In my '85 I need super, in my '87 I can use regular.I use castrol 10w30. Putting synthetic after dino oil can cause leaks.
